负载测试、压力测试、可靠性测试、容量测试的异同点

1.负载测试是逐步增加压力,来找到性能拐点,主要是为了找性能指标,比如服务器最大承受的并发用户数是45,为了找到这个指标,我们一开始施加的用户是20个,每次递增10个,到40个用户的时候服务器还能抗住,再增加10个到50的时候,服务器已经出现了异常,不能正常提供服务,此时我们可以找到服务器能承载的并发用户在40-50之间,然后再每次增加一个用户,就可以找到服务器最大的并发用户数是45—-关键词:逐步增加压力,找到拐点

2.压力测试是在测试服务器在高并发的情况下,持续运行较长时间,看服务器是否能正常提供服务,压力测试的前提是已经进行了负载测试,只要服务最大能接受多大的负载,然后再最大的负载下进行长时间运行,一般是运行24小时的倍数。因为较长时间运行,可以测试出系统是否有内存泄漏等问题—关键词:持续运行较长时间

3.可靠性测试跟压力测试区别不大,最大的区别是稳定性测试没有压力测试那么长时间,常见于秒杀系统,秒杀时时间点是固定的,服务器只在很短的实际内有高并发—关键词:持续时间短

4.容量测试是值在特别多的数据的情况下进行测试,看服务器响应有没有变慢,同一个查询接口,如果数据过多,查询没有优化,用少量数据是无法测试出来性能的----关键词:大量数据

个人理解,如有不对,请指正

性能测试之负载测试、压力测试、可靠性测试和容量测试的区别相关推荐

  1. 性能测试方法详解(验收性能、负载、压力、配置、并发、可靠性、失败恢复)

    一.性能测试 性能测试时通过自动化测试工具模拟多种正常.峰值以及异常负载条件来对系统的各项性能指标进行测试.负载测试和压力测试都属于性能测试,两者可以结合进行,通过负载测试,确定在各种工作负载下系统的 ...

  2. 服务器终端性能测试之GPU burn压力测试

    GPU burn 测试GPU 1.下载软件 wget https://codeload.github.com/wilicc/gpu-burn/zip/master 2.解压缩 unzip gpu-bu ...

  3. 性能测试, 压力测试 , 负载测试和 容量测试 的区别与联系

    负载测试(Load Test).压力测试(Stress Test).容量测试(Capability Test)与性能测试(Performance Test)是相互关系? 性能测试包括负载测试.压力测试 ...

  4. 性能测试之性能测试、负载测试、压力测试、稳定性测试概念简单理解和区分

    性能测试概念描述: 以系统设计初期规划的性能指标为预期目标,对系统不断施加压力,验证系统在资源可接受范围内,是否能达到性能瓶颈. 关键词提取理解:有性能指标,验证 性能测试目标: 1.验证系统的性能指 ...

  5. 压测瓶颈在mysql_MySQL的性能基线收集及压力测试

    建立基线的作用: 计算机科学中,基线是项目储存库中每个工件版本在特定时期的一个"快照". 比如我们现在有并发事物,那么在某时刻发起一个事物会产生当前数据的快照,那么这个快照就相当理 ...

  6. php mysql 压力测试_MySQL的性能基线收集及压力测试

    建立基线的作用: 计算机科学中,基线是项目储存库中每个工件版本在特定时期的一个"快照". 比如我们现在有并发事物,那么在某时刻发起一个事物会产生当前数据的快照,那么这个快照就相当理 ...

  7. 数据库MySQL的性能基线收集及压力测试

    建立基线的作用: 计算机科学中,基线是项目储存库中每个工件版本在特定时期的一个"快照". 比如我们现在有并发事物,那么在某时刻发起一个事物会产生当前数据的快照,那么这个快照就相当理 ...

  8. 性能测试 理论初探(三),什么是性能测试分类?性能测试有哪些?性能测试分类 性能测试场景分析 负载测试、压力测试、容量测试等

    文章目录 前言 负载测试(Load Testing) 压力测试(Stress Testing) 容量测试(Volume Testing) 性能测试类型 1.基准测试 2.争用测试 3.性能配置 4.负 ...

  9. 性能测试,负载测试,压力测试以及容量测试的联系与区别--网搜及总结

    1.负载测试,英文是Load testing. 负载测试是性能测试的一种,测试一个应用在重负荷下的表现.例如测试一个 Web 站点在大量的负荷下,何时系统的响应会退化或失败,以发现设计上的错误或验证系 ...

最新文章

  1. 解决Office 2010出现the setup controller has encountered a problem...
  2. content add tpl.php,phpcms后台批量上传添加图片文章方法详解(一)
  3. TIJ摘要:访问控制权限
  4. 【MySQL】MySQL 使用where条件的三种方式
  5. 关于机器学习 Machine Learning中loss函数参数正则化的一点思考
  6. python rsa加密解密 字符串_python_rsa加密解密
  7. MPLS virtual private network中MCE介绍
  8. 个人h5第三方支付接口_个人免签支付接口系统搭建源码多种方式
  9. python学习笔记(52周存钱挑战)
  10. c语言入门这一篇就够了-学习笔记(一万字)
  11. sa是什么职位_解决方案架构师是做什么的:流程,角色描述,责任和成果
  12. laaS 、paaS和SaaS区别
  13. UE支持的Codec对比
  14. UE开机入网流程及RRC连接建立
  15. 开源的悲哀——袁萌100天变身实录[3]
  16. 计算机编程逻辑图,【图片】【附C++编程演示】计算机思维生成之逻辑编程篇【人工智能吧】_百度贴吧...
  17. LoadRunner 技巧之 集合点设置
  18. 信息资源管理【一】之 信息资源管理基础
  19. python数据分析就业前景_数据分析师找工作的秘诀,从读懂招聘 JD 开始
  20. 呼吸心跳信号检测方法(一)

热门文章

  1. Java Resources 出现红色叹号的解决方法
  2. 代码审计--CatfishCMS文件上传漏洞
  3. co01设置错误消息_sw2014打开装配体,提示数据库设置错误
  4. github下载的matlab代码,如何从GitHub存储库下载代码
  5. 智慧用电安全管理系统
  6. python爬取网易藏宝阁手机版_Python3 TensorFlow打造人脸识别智能小程序
  7. lightgbm API参数解释
  8. 运营商数据:苹果用户流失 华为魅族势头强劲
  9. mysql五日均线_[转载]老股民坚持使用的五日均线战法,从不被套,简单实用
  10. 兔子试毒 #算法学习